Wine Tasting This Saturday!

Join us this Saturday, October 17 from noon until 2 p.m. to try some really interesting wines from Big Boat Wine Company. Leigh McDaniel will be here tasting out a Muller Thurgau from Southern Oregon and a truly delicious sparkling wine made from Ugni Blanc and Colombard out of France. Cote du Rhone blends have also proven to be a big favorite of our guests and so we're going to be tasting and offering yet another delicious Cote du Rhone blend. As always, this is a FREE event. Although, you must have your identification to taste.



Live in your city! Know your city!

Are you ready to vote in the upcoming city wide elections on November 3? In the past 13 months, we have learned first hand at The Mercantile how valuable and important it is to be involved in your community and have good information when it comes time to elect your city officials. Our elected city council members play a very important role in our lives as they determine how our city is governed. Over the next few weeks at The Mercantile, you'll have an opportunity to meet a number of people seeking a seat on the city council. We invite you to stop by, meet some of these folks, inquire about their platform and get ready to vote on November 3.

Saturday, October 17, 12 pm - 2 pm, Meet Steve Brodie. Steve is running for the highly contested seat of District 6. The Mercantile is located in District 6. This District is known for being politically active and this race is going to be a really interesting one to watch. You may recall that Steve Brodie ran for this seat in the last election and was very narrowly defeated. Can't wait to see what happens on this round!

Sunday, October 18, 12 pm - 2 pm, Meet Shelitha Robertson. Ms. Robertson is running for an At Large Post. The At Large seats represent the entire city! These are important candidates to watch. Ms. Robertson has extensive experience with the city of Atlanta including 10 years as a police officer.

Also on Sunday, October 18, 12 pm - 2 pm you will have an opportunity to meet Jesse Spikes, a candidate for mayor! We are looking forward to learning more about Mr. Spikes when he arrives on Sunday.
